双活性磺酸基蔗渣木聚糖对羟基苯甲酸酯的合成及活性模拟

摘    要:以蔗渣木聚糖(BX)为主要原料、氨基三磺酸钠为酯化剂,在一步酯化合成磺酸基蔗渣木聚糖酯的基础上,利用磺酸基蔗渣木聚糖酯和对羟基苯甲酸进行二步酯化反应,合成了磺酸基蔗渣木聚糖对羟基苯甲酸酯,并考察了反应条件对酯化反应的影响,通过单因素实验确定了第二步酯化反应较佳的合成工艺条件.蔗渣木聚糖酯化改性前后的样品分别用FT-IR,DG-DTG和XRD进行了表征,并对该双酯化衍生物的分子进行了优化与活性模拟.结果表明:FT-IR证明双酯化产物含有磺酸基团和对羟基苯甲酸酯基团,TG-DTG分析表明该双酯化衍生物的热稳定性提高,XRD说明发生双酯化改性后分子排列的规整性提高,结晶度增加;活性模拟实现了磺酸基蔗渣木聚糖对羟基苯甲酸酯与艾滋病毒的对接.

Synthesis and properties investigation of dual active sulfonic groups bagasse xylan paraben

Abstract:The sulfonic groups bagasse xylan ester was synthesized by using bagasse xylan as the raw material and three amino sulfonic acid sodium as esterifying agent,and then the sulfonic groups bagasse paraben was synthesized by esterifying p-hydroxy benzoic acid onto sulfonic groups bagasse xylan ester.The effects of reaction conditions were studied.The optimum conditions for the synthesis of the second step esterification were decided by single factor experiment.The samples of bagasse xylan before and after esterification were characterized by FT-IR,DG-DTG and XRD,respectively,the molecular structure and activity of double-ester derivative were optimized and simulated.The results indicated that double esterified derivative contain sulfonic acid groups and p-hydroxy benzoic acid ester groups by the FT-IR.The TG-DTG analysis showed that the thermal stability of the double ester derivatives has been improved.The XRD results indicated that the molecular arrangement of the double esterification modified molecule was enhanced,and the crystallinity was increased.The docking of the sulfonic groups bagasse paraben and the AIDS virus was achieved through the active simulation.
